Missouri Southern State University offers undergrad degrees, minors, graduate degrees, and certificate courses for undergrad and grad students. Some of the its courses may be conducted online or distance learning mode. The university was founded as Joplin Junior College.

Tuition Fees at Missouri Southern State University

Missouri Southern State University tuition fees for both bachelor's and master's students are discussed in this section.

Bachelor's Tuition Fees

Student Type Annual Tuition Fees in USD
Domestic Students 6,421 USD - 12,841 USD
International Students 12,841 USD

Master's Tuition Fees

Student Type Annual Tuition Fees in USD
Domestic Students 6,300 USD
International Students 6,300 USD

Although this range provide a good estimate of tuition costs at Missouri Southern State University, the actual fees depend on your chosen program. Thus, for more exact figures, you may refer to Missouri Southern State University tuition fee pages.
